Tamil dictionary
Source: DDSA: University of Madras: Tamil LexiconTūraṟu (தூரறு) [tūraṟuttal] [tūr-aṟu] intransitive verb < தூர் [thur] +. To root out; மூலநாசஞ்செய்தல். அமணர்தூ ரறுத் தான் [mulanasancheythal. amanarthu raruth than] (பெரியபுராணம் திருநாவு. [periyapuranam thirunavu.] 298).
